The year is 2013 and Snake Plissken is back but this time it’s L.A., which through the agency of earthquakes has become an island of the damned. But something has gone wrong in this new moral order, because the President’s daughter has absconded to L.A. with a detonation device, and Snake is commandeered to retrieve it. Escape from L.A. (1996) is a gripping action-adventure sci-fi movie that captivates audiences with its thrilling plot and dynamic characters. Directed by the legendary John Carpenter, this film serves as the sequel to the cult classic Escape from New York (1981). With an engaging storyline, stellar performances by the cast, and a futuristic setting, it remains a memorable entry in 90s cinema, especially within the action and sci-fi genres.

Plot Summary:

The story unfolds in a dystopian future where Los Angeles has been converted into a maximum-security prison island after a massive earthquake isolates it from the mainland. The U.S. government uses this highly secured island, known simply as "The Island," to incarcerate society's criminals and those who defy the new regime.

The protagonist, Snake Plissken (played by Kurt Russell), is a former Special Forces operator and anti-hero who becomes humanity's reluctant savior once again. After retrieving a mysterious and powerful object known as "The Containment Box," a powerful device capable of turning off all electrical power on the West Coast, the government calls upon Plissken to infiltrate the island and rescue the President’s daughter, Utopia Hawkins (played by Stacy Keach's real-life daughter, presumably, though actually played by another actress), who has crashed there with the device.

Snake's mission is dangerous and layered with political intrigue, as the island is ruled by the ruthless Cuervo Jones (played by Cliff Robertson), who has transformed the island into his own empire. Cuervo Jones is a charismatic yet treacherous antagonist who commands an army of henchmen, including the wheelchair-bound Duke (Peter Fonda), and the eccentric Bruce (Steve Buscemi), who adds a mix of dark humor to the film.

Throughout the movie, Plissken faces various challenges including mutated creatures, anarchists, and betrayals, all while navigating the treacherous terrain of the prison island. The film interweaves high-octane action sequences with satirical commentary on government control, individual freedom, and the direction society might be headed.

Direction and Writing:

The film was directed by John Carpenter, renowned for his expertise in blending horror, action, and science fiction. Carpenter also co-wrote the screenplay, alongside Debra Hill, Nick Castle, and Kurt Russell. Their collaboration brought to life a script that balances intense action with a dystopian and satirical edge, typical of Carpenter’s signature style. The writing also elevates the film’s antagonists and supporting characters, giving them enough depth to create meaningful conflict with the protagonist.

Visual Style and Themes:

Carpenter’s direction is notable for its dystopian depiction of a future Los Angeles transformed into a prison, combining elements of chaos, decay, and authoritarian control. The film’s visual aesthetic is gritty and bleak, capturing the spirit of a society pushed to the edge. The action sequences are fast-paced and well-choreographed, drawing viewers into the dangerous world Plissken inhabits.

The movie grapples with themes such as the loss of freedom, government surveillance, and the impact of technology on society. It also features a strong anti-authoritarian message embodied by Snake Plissken, who operates as a symbol of resistance against oppressive regimes.

Reception and Legacy:

While not as critically acclaimed as its predecessor, Escape from L.A. has earned a solid cult following over the years. Fans appreciate its witty dialogue, Kurt Russell’s charismatic performance, and Carpenter’s visionary direction. The movie’s mix of dark humor and social commentary resonates with audiences interested in dystopian futures and anti-hero narratives.
